33问答网
所有问题
当前搜索:
long和float哪个范围大
java中为什么
long
的
范围
小于
float
?求解答
答:
因为
long
要存储严格的整数,有严格的
范围
限制,精度永远为1
float
是浮动精度。支持小数,但数值达到一定大的时候,就会出现误差。当float的值达到一定大小,程序中遇到2个float比较的时候会出现应该相等,但结果不等,或者应该不等却相等的情况。因为float是有误差的 long没有误差,但不能有小数。。
long和float
、 double之间的区别是
什么
?
答:
1、
long
:默认为有符号长整型,含4个字节。2、
float
:用于存储单精度浮点数或双精度浮点数。3、double:表示十进制的15或16位有效数字。三、取值
范围
不同 1、 long:取值范围为:-2^31 ~ (2^31 -1)。2、float: float 类型提供了一个在 -3.4E+38 ~ 3.4E+38 之间的范围。3、double:...
C语言中
long
float
double有
什么
区别
答:
long 是long
int 长整数,表示的范围不小于int float是浮点数,double是双精度浮点数,表示的范围不小于float 一般32系统下,long占4字节,float占4字节,double占8字节。
java 中byte.short,int,
long
,
float
,double 的取值
范围
分别是多少?
答:
double型比float型存储范围更大
,精度更高,所以通常的浮点型的数据在不声明的情况下都是double型的,如果要表示一个数据是float型的,可以在数据后面加上“F”。浮点型的数据是不能完全精确的,所以有的时候在计算的时候可能会在小数点最后几位出现浮动,这是正常的。
float
和int都是32位,为啥表示
范围
不同?还有
long和
int又啥区别?_百度知 ...
答:
。long和int区别为:
存储不同、数据范围不同、机器字长不同
。一、存储不同 1、long:long用于存储长整数类型变量。2、int:int用于存储整数类型变量。二、数据长度不同 1、long:long不受编译器限制,数据长度是标准的8bytes。2、int:int受编译器限制,不同编译器数据长度不同可以是8、16bytes。
java语言的所有数据类型分为哪几种?
答:
JAVA中一共有八种基本数据类型,分别是:byte、short、int、
long
、
float
、double、char、boolean。1、byte:8位,最大存储数据量是255,存放的数据
范围
是-128~127之间。2、short:16位,最大数据存储量是65536,数据范围是-32768~32767之间。3、int:32位,最大数据存储容量是2的32次方减1,数据范围...
float
为什么比
long大
答:
科学计数法一个E38就代表38位
Long
最多才能表示19位的十进制数 两者不是一个数量级的
float
的表示数字是数值乘以10的N次方得到的。N大于0的时候表示大数,N小于零的时候代表小数
JAVA中8个数据类型的取值
范围
是多少?
答:
long
的取值
范围
为(-9223372036854774808~9223372036854774807),占用8个字节(-2的63次方到2的63次方-1);可以看到byte和short的取值范围比较小,而long的取值范围太大,占用的空间多,基本上int可以满足我们的日常的计算了,而且int也是使用的最多的整型类型了。在通常情况下,如果JAVA中出现了一个整数...
哪个
数据类型的长度最大?(int, char,
long
,
float
) java
答:
long
(长整型) 64
float
(浮点型) 32 char(字符型) 16 int(整型) 32 所以long的长度最大...
整型(int,
long
)各能容纳多长的数据?精度(
float
,double)的呢?_百度...
答:
类型 比特数 有效数字 数值
范围
float
32 6-7 -3.4*10(-38)~3.4*10(38)double 64 15-16 -1.7*10(-308)~1.7*10(308)
long
double 128 18-19 -1.2*10(-4932)~1.2*10(4932)int long -2147483648~2147483647
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
为什么long比float小
long类型和float类型谁大
java中long和float哪个范围大
long和int的范围一样
float在不同平台长度
int和float哪个范围大
float的整数位数
float和long有什么区别
float整数部分可以有几位